Thatching is the procedure of getting rid of the layer of dead yard, roots, and organic particles that builds up in between the soil and living grass, which can restrain water, air, and nutrient absorption. Extreme thatch can lead to shallow root systems, increased pest issues, and irregular development. Strategies for thatching consist of manual raking or the use of specialized dethatching devices that lifts and gets rid of the layer without damaging healthy grass The procedure is typically followed by aeration, overseeding, or fertilization to promote healthy healing and growth. Routine thatching guarantees better soil-to-grass contact, enhances nutrient uptake, and keeps a lavish, resilient lawn. Incorporating thatching into yard care routines enhances both the look and long-lasting health of grass.
